Understanding Resin Driveways
Resin driveways are constructed by mixing premium aggregate (like gravel or decorative stone) with a translucent resin. This combination is then applied across a prepared surface, forming a level and solid finish. The final product is a driveway that looks earthy yet modern, accommodating different property styles in and around Preston.

Ground Preparation
The first step involves removing any old materials and verifying a level foundation. Proper water management is also important, so most installers will examine for slopes and install the required drainage solutions.
Base Layer
After the ground is prepared, a sub-base (often Type 1 sub-base or something similar) is installed and compacted. This layer provides a stable support for the resin mix.
Mixing and Laying Resin
The chosen aggregate is mixed with the resin before being layered evenly onto the base. The final layer is smoothed out to achieve a consistent thickness.
Curing Time
Once the resin is laid, it needs a few hours to cure. During this period, it’s important to keep vehicles, pets, and foot traffic off the surface to stop any indentations.

Resin Driveway Care
Regular Cleaning
Keep leaves, dirt, and debris off the surface to preserve its appearance. A broom or moderate pressure wash usually suffice.
Immediate Spill Cleanup
If oil or other spills occur, clean them up quickly to prevent potential staining.
Avoid Extreme Loads
While resin is tough, parking very heavy vehicles or machinery for long periods might stress the surface. Evenly place heavy loads where possible, particularly if you more info have caravans or large vehicles.
